Our take

Where DELMIAWorks leads

  • Stronger evidenced coverage on 8 of the 24 capabilities where they differ (led by ai / ml-based visual inspection and mobile & wearable device support).

Where Siemens Opcenter leads

  • Stronger evidenced coverage on 16 of the 24 capabilities where they differ (led by electronic work instructions and batch & recipe management).
  • Stated SAP, Oracle Fusion Cloud, Microsoft Dynamics 365 integration the alternative doesn't list.

Where they differ

The 24 capabilities (of 50 in the manufacturing (MES / PLM) taxonomy) where the evidence separates them, biggest gaps first. “Not evidenced” means our research found no public documentation of this capability — the vendor may still offer it. Confirm on a demo.

DELMIAWorks vs Siemens Opcenter — FAQs

Is DELMIAWorks or Siemens Opcenter better for ERP integration?

They state different ERP coverage: DELMIAWorks lists no ERP integrations publicly; Siemens Opcenter lists SAP, Oracle Fusion Cloud, Microsoft Dynamics 365.

Which is cheaper, DELMIAWorks or Siemens Opcenter?

Neither publishes a list price — both quote. Ask each for the all-in first-year cost at your seat count, as one number, and compare those.
